Awnings. Only air awnings can be left up during the winter season (31/10-31/3). • All other awnings erected during the summer season must be pegged out with marquee pegs, an over the top storm strap and internal ratchets straps. Extra roof poles are always advisable as is an awning specifically manufactured for permanent seasonal use. Failure to secure your awning could result in being requested to take it down if it is deemed a safety risk. • If during the season summer or winter when air or poled awnings are they left up & storms & high winds are forecast of which you will be fully aware, you are completely responsible for attending site immediately afterwards if any damage has occurred, to tidy up your pitch of the damaged awning and the belongings within to ensure it is once again tidy & safe. This may mean attending site outside your normal expected times so please bear this is mind if you live several hours away from site, as we do NOT pack up belongings or damaged awnings, this is completely your responsibility and choice by leaving an awning erected in these circumstances. If you fail to attend site within 24 hours of such damage your contract will be reviewed • Damaged awnings must be removed from site by the caravan owner and not left in the recycling area - any awnings left on site in this manner will incur a £35 disposal fee
